That site is visually very attractive and seems to fuction quite well, however, (and you saw this coming, didn't you?), smile.gif, there are a couple of things you might consider changing.

1. validate your code, especially if you are handing it over to a customer. It will show a level of professionalism for your work, and probably work better in multiple Browsers.
http://validator.w3.org/check?uri=http%3A%...et%2Fport3.html
Doctype Declarations are essential for the Web, and they will become more and more critical as the Web develops new services and as the Specifications change.

2. There seems to be too much stuff "below the fold". I must scroll down on each page to see the content I would be looking for. Basically, shorten the header stuff and display the changing content for the page the client is looking at.

3. Centre the page? My laptop has a wide screen display format, and the page is all crowded over to the left hand side. Wide screens are becoming more popular all the time.

As I said at the start, visually this is a very attractive and well done site.
